Complete Buyer's Guide: How to Choose Wireless Headphones for Work From Home

1. Noise Cancellation: Your Secret Weapon for Professional Calls

When you’re working from home, background noise from household activities, street traffic, or even air conditioning can disrupt your calls and make you sound unprofessional. Look for headsets with AI noise cancellation or environmental noise cancellation (ENC) that specifically target background sounds while keeping your voice clear. Advanced models combine both active and environmental noise cancellation for maximum effectiveness.

2. Battery Life: How Long Do You Really Need?

For all-day use without constant charging anxiety, aim for at least 40 hours of battery life. This typically covers a full workweek of meetings and calls without needing to recharge. Some models offer fast charging capabilities that provide several hours of use from just a short charging session, which can be a lifesaver when you forget to plug in overnight.

3. Connectivity Options: Bluetooth vs. Dongle Explained

Most wireless headsets offer Bluetooth connectivity, but a USB dongle can provide more stable performance on computers, especially if your device has unreliable Bluetooth. Look for models with multipoint connectivity that allow you to pair with two devices simultaneously—perfect for switching between your computer and phone without re-pairing.

4. Comfort That Lasts Through Marathon Sessions

Since you’ll be wearing these for hours, prioritize lightweight designs with breathable ear cushions and adjustable headbands. Over-ear models generally provide better noise isolation, while on-ear options can be more compact. Memory foam cushions and protein leather materials often offer the best combination of comfort and durability for long-term use.

5. Microphone Quality and Mute Features That Actually Work

A high-quality microphone with effective noise cancellation is crucial for professional communication. Features like flip-to-mute or one-touch mute buttons add convenience and prevent embarrassing moments. Some models include visual mute indicators so everyone knows when you’re silenced—no more ‘you’re on mute’ reminders during important presentations.

6. Compatibility with Your Favorite Meeting Platforms

Ensure the headset works seamlessly with Zoom, Microsoft Teams, Webex, and other platforms you use regularly. Most modern wireless headsets are plug-and-play compatible, but checking specifically for your software can prevent connectivity issues. Some models offer optimized profiles for popular conferencing apps.

7. Single-Ear vs. Dual-Ear: Which Design Suits Your Work Style?

Single-ear headsets allow you to maintain awareness of your surroundings, which is ideal if you need to hear doorbells, children, or other environmental sounds. Dual-ear designs provide immersive sound and better noise isolation, making them perfect for focused work or music listening during breaks. Your choice depends on whether situational awareness or audio immersion is more important for your workflow.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Can I use wireless headphones with my computer if it doesn't have Bluetooth?

Absolutely! Many wireless headsets come with a USB dongle that plugs directly into your computer’s USB port, providing a stable wireless connection without requiring Bluetooth capability. This often results in more reliable performance than Bluetooth, especially on older computers or in environments with wireless interference.

2. How important is noise cancellation for work calls?

Extremely important! Effective noise cancellation ensures your voice comes through clearly while minimizing background distractions like keyboard typing, household noises, or street sounds. This professional audio quality prevents misunderstandings and makes you sound more polished during client calls and team meetings.

3. What's the difference between ANC and ENC in headphones?

ANC (Active Noise Cancellation) uses microphones and advanced processing to reduce ambient noise for your listening experience, while ENC (Environmental Noise Cancellation) focuses on canceling noise from your environment that the person on the other end of the call would hear. Some premium headsets include both technologies for comprehensive noise management.

4. How long should the battery last for a full workday?

For typical 8-hour workdays, look for headsets with at least 40 hours of battery life to cover a full workweek without frequent charging. Many models now offer 65+ hours, which provides ample buffer for unexpected long meetings or forgetfulness about charging routines.

5. Are single-ear or dual-ear headsets better for work?

It depends on your work environment and preferences. Single-ear headsets are ideal if you need to maintain situational awareness of your surroundings, while dual-ear designs provide better immersion and noise isolation for focused work. Many remote workers prefer dual-ear for video conferences but might choose single-ear for roles requiring frequent environmental awareness.
